a { color: #008; }

#welcome h1 {
  padding: 20px; 
  text-align: center; 
  background: #447e40; 
  color: #fff;
  }
  
h2 { background: #ddd; text-align: center; padding: 4px; }

#welcome p { font-size: 1.3em; color: #444; text-align:center;}

#header { }
#footer { background: #ddd;}
#footer a { color: #444; }

.info, .fork { padding: 10px; }
.content { font-size: 1.2em; }
.content h3 { background: #dfd; font-size: 1.7em; padding: 6px 2px; }
.content h1 { font-size: 1.4em; padding: 6px 2px; }

pre { padding: 20px; background: #ffd; font-size: 0.9em; }

#links { padding: 10px; }

#header #links { text-align:right; }
#header #links a { color: #555; font-size: 1.2em; padding: 5px; margin: 10px; }

.title { background: #dfd; font-size: 1.4em; font-weight:bold; padding: 3px 3px;}
.title a { color: #252; }
.episode p { padding: 3px; font-size: 1.1em;}

